Keith Urban has another No. 1 hit under his belt. 'Somewhere in My Car' has reached the top spot on the Billboard Country Airplay chart.

The single is Urban's fourth release from his latest album, 'Fuse,' and the third single from the record to hit No. 1, following 'We Were Us,' his collaboration with Miranda Lambert.

Urban got the idea for the song, which he co-wrote with J.T. Harding, while in his car.

“I had a day scheduled to write with him, and I had just gotten this song, this particular song that I heard and downloaded by a particular artist, and I loved the rhythm and the energy and the whole thing about it,” Urban says. “I got J.T. and put him in the car and turned it up as loud as I could and said, ‘[Yelling] We need something like this!’ But a similar song structure -- and the song was born of that.”
